Ethical Mineral Sourcing in Africa: A Growing Imperative

The expanding need for essential minerals in Africa is fostering a substantial focus on ethical sourcing . Historically , mineral mining in the region has been linked to serious human rights issues and ecological degradation. As a result, organizations are progressively confronting calls from stakeholders and regulators to verify ethical mineral supply chains . This shift necessitates improved visibility and due diligence to prevent abuse and promote equitable practices for regional people and safeguard the ecosystem .

Basic Commodity Suppliers in Africa : Developments and Prospective Outlook

Many African countries are key exporters of raw goods, including minerals , oil and farm products . Currently , worldwide need for these assets remains fairly consistent , although instability in values persists to be a difficulty . The upcoming forecast is shaped by elements such as growing demographics within the continent , shifting worldwide usage patterns , and this need for sustainable extraction approaches. In the end , funding in infrastructure and processing networks will be essential for enhancing returns and ensuring sustainable development for affected producers.
